Columbia Point, Boston, MA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Columbia Point?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Columbia Point Studio Apartments | $2,577 | $2,000 | $3,657 |
| Columbia Point 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,536 | $1,240 | $4,188 |
| Columbia Point 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,500 | $1,800 | $7,880 |
| Columbia Point 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,587 | $2,100 | $6,336 |
| Columbia Point 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,233 | $1,100 | $7,200 |
| Columbia Point 5 Bedroom Apartments | $5,849 | $4,100 | $7,000 |
